3.1.0

This release includes accessibility improvements, pre-commit hooks, and various enhancements.

  • Accessibility improvements:
    • Underline links inside main content, to make them recognizable without color.
    • Improve contrast of link colors
    • Add ARIA names to sidebar social icons.
  • Add pre-commit hooks for code quality:
    • djlint for Jinja2 templates
    • Trailing whitespace
    • JSON/YAML checker
    • Assets build
  • Move static/, templates/, and translations/ directories back to root to make it easier to use the theme from source code (e.g. a git clone). Reflex remains installable via PyPI with the same interface.
  • Upgrade Isso to 0.13.0.
  • Highlight Isso comments made by the page author.
  • Refactor footer templates.
  • Remove Flex-inherited Google Analytics config.
  • Mark AddThis as defunct in README (will be removed in Reflex 4.0.0).

3.0.0

First release after forking off Flex v2.5 by alexandrevicenzi.

This is the first release on PyPI as pelican-reflex. (the release was buggy and was pulled)

Changes since Flex 2.5:

  • gulp watch support.
  • Style for toc markdown extension.
  • Fix styles for figure and figcaption HTML elements.
  • Shynet tracking support.
  • In-repo documentation instead of Github wiki.
  • Updated Pygments styles, new themes available.
  • Updated FontAwesome to 6.7.2.
  • Make <strong> text bold (it was being overridden inside <blockquote> and potentially other tags)
  • Revamped example site for testing and demonstration.
  • Display language flags for alternative article languages.
  • X (formerly Twitter) social icon.
  • AGENTS.md for AI development.
  • GitHub Actions workflows for CI/CD.

Thanks to Loïc Penaud for contributing the gulp watch task.
